### Runbook: Invoicer render stalls

If Invoicer starts queuing PDFs instead of rendering them, it's almost always the font cache or a wedged worker. Restart the render pool first — it's cheap and fixes 90% of cases. If invoices come out with blank line items, the template bundle didn't load; re-pull it and bounce the service. Don't touch the queue manually, it self-heals. A healthy instance should report the following configuration values.

settings of kahap-kahof:
[aldvan]
port = 6379
team = istox
host = aldvan.plorvalabs.internal
region = west-1
access_code = ac_e12344
timeout_ms = 2000

Handover — CSV import wizard (Gridfall)

Importer is stable. Known issue: the wizard's column-mapping step chokes on BOM-prefixed files; workaround is the strip-bom flag in the parser config. Batch jobs over 50k rows go through the Quillbatch worker, not inline. Don't restart the worker mid-job — it loses row offsets. If the staging credentials store locks itself after a failed deploy (happens roughly monthly), unlock it using the recovery passphrase that follows this note.

vault phrase of bagaf-kajeg = jorath-feniel-briir-siliel-ralix

**TKT-4471: Signature check failing on Scanbridge builds**

Scanbridge barcode plugin fails verify step since Tuesday's CI migration. Artifacts built fine; verification rejects them. Root cause: verifier still pinned to retired key. Fix: repoint to current key, rebuild, re-verify. Blocking the Lanefield pilot. Current signing key for the verifier is below.

deploy key for kajof-fajop: bky6_gDHw9Q

### Changelog — Spoolhaven v2.9

Heads up for the sync: we renamed `SPOOL_QUEUE_MODE` to `SPOOL_DISPATCH_MODE` because the old name kept confusing new folks. The deprecated alias is gone as of this release, so update your env files. Also, the dispatcher now talks to the print broker over mTLS, which means the env file needs its client credential on this line:

secret setting of hawep-yahig: LEDGER_TOKEN29=41b5d6315371c92885eaeb077fb63